Output ed58f6aeabc27f5fb80a449a12f485c79e21a6a9c3de5da70c52b68d9d2e0980:0

value
147723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99dbd2808286814eafcbebaad2e4f29bb8bba83 OP_EQUAL
address
3L54hzVSeuSncF19uJfAJizXYB7qRwRGAU
transaction
ed58f6aeabc27f5fb80a449a12f485c79e21a6a9c3de5da70c52b68d9d2e0980
confirmations
48859
spent
true